Why Is a Voltage Stabilizer Essential for a 300 Litre Refrigerator?

A voltage stabilizer is essential for a 300-litre refrigerator due to several critical reasons:

  • Voltage Fluctuations: Refrigerators operate optimally within a specific voltage range. Fluctuating electrical currents can lead to inefficient cooling or even damage the compressor, leading to costly repairs.

  • Compressor Protection: The compressor is the heart of the refrigerator. A stabilizer helps maintain a steady voltage, preventing overworking or underworking of the compressor, which can extend its lifespan.

  • Energy Efficiency: Stabilizers optimize the power supply, ensuring that the refrigerator consumes energy efficiently. This not only leads to lower electricity bills but also contributes to reducing overall energy consumption.

  • Durability and Performance: Consistent voltage supply prevents wear and tear on the refrigerator components, enhancing its overall performance and longevity.

  • Safety Features: Most voltage stabilizers come with built-in safety features such as overvoltage protection, which safeguards the refrigerator from electrical surges, making it a prudent investment for preserving appliance integrity.

In summary, using a voltage stabilizer for a 300-litre refrigerator is crucial for operational efficiency, energy conservation, and protection against electrical issues.

What Key Features Should You Look For in a Stabilizer for a 300 Litre Refrigerator?

When selecting the best stabilizer for a 300 litre refrigerator, certain key features are essential to ensure optimal performance and protection.

  • Voltage Range: A stabilizer should have a wide voltage range to accommodate fluctuations in the electrical supply. This ensures that your refrigerator operates efficiently, preventing damage from low or high voltage situations.
  • Load Capacity: It’s crucial to choose a stabilizer that can handle the load of your refrigerator. For a 300 litre model, look for a stabilizer with a capacity of at least 1.5 to 2 times the refrigerator’s wattage to ensure reliable performance.
  • Response Time: A quick response time is vital in protecting your refrigerator from voltage fluctuations. A stabilizer with a response time of under 1 second can help keep your appliance safe from potential damage caused by sudden surges or drops in voltage.
  • Overload Protection: This feature protects the stabilizer and the connected appliance from damage due to excessive load. It automatically disconnects the circuit when the load exceeds the specified limit, preventing overheating and potential fire hazards.
  • Compact Design: A compact design is beneficial for saving space, especially in small kitchens. It allows for easy installation and placement without cluttering the area around the refrigerator.
  • Indicator Lights: LED indicator lights provide visual feedback on the stabilizer’s operation status, such as power input, output status, and fault indication. This feature helps users monitor the performance and troubleshoot issues easily.
  • Warranty and Service: A good warranty period and reliable customer service are essential when investing in a stabilizer. This ensures that you receive support for any potential issues and can have peace of mind regarding the product’s durability.

How Can a Stabilizer Prevent Common Refrigeration Issues?

A stabilizer can help prevent common refrigeration issues by regulating voltage and protecting the refrigerator from power fluctuations.

  • Voltage Regulation: A stabilizer continuously monitors the incoming voltage and adjusts it to a safe level, ensuring that the refrigerator operates within its optimal voltage range. This protection helps prevent compressor failure and prolongs the lifespan of the appliance.
  • Surge Protection: Power surges can occur due to lightning strikes or sudden power outages, which can damage sensitive electronic components in a refrigerator. A stabilizer provides surge protection by absorbing the extra voltage and preventing it from reaching the refrigerator.
  • Overload Protection: Many stabilizers come equipped with overload protection features that shut off the power supply when the load exceeds the stabilizer’s capacity. This prevents overheating and potential fire hazards associated with overloaded circuits.
  • Low Voltage Cut-off: In situations where the voltage drops below a certain threshold, a stabilizer can disconnect the refrigerator from the power supply. This feature prevents the compressor from trying to operate under low voltage, which can lead to overheating and damage.
  • Noise Filtering: Stabilizers can filter out electrical noise and harmonics that may interfere with the refrigerator’s operation. This helps maintain the efficiency of the cooling system and enhances its overall performance.

How Often Should You Service or Replace Your Refrigerator Stabilizer?

Understanding how often to service or replace your refrigerator stabilizer is crucial for maintaining optimal performance and longevity.

  • Regular Maintenance: It is recommended to check your refrigerator stabilizer at least once a year to ensure it is functioning properly.
  • Indicators for Replacement: If you notice frequent voltage fluctuations or your refrigerator isn’t cooling efficiently, it may be time to replace the stabilizer.
  • Age of the Stabilizer: Generally, stabilizers should be replaced every 3 to 5 years, depending on usage and environmental conditions.
  • Manufacturer Guidelines: Always refer to the manufacturer’s specifications for your specific refrigerator model, as they may have particular recommendations for servicing or replacement.
  • Environmental Factors: In areas with unstable voltage or extreme temperature fluctuations, more frequent checks or earlier replacement may be necessary.

Regular maintenance involves inspecting the stabilizer’s connections, checking for any visible damage, and ensuring that it is clean and free of dust. This can help prevent issues that may arise due to neglect.

Indicators for replacement include signs such as the refrigerator running continuously without proper cooling, unusual noises, or the stabilizer itself showing wear and tear. If these symptoms are present, it’s advisable to consult a technician.

The age of the stabilizer plays a significant role in its reliability, as older units may not handle current demands effectively. Staying aware of how long you’ve had your stabilizer can help in planning for its replacement.

Manufacturer guidelines serve as a valuable resource as they take into account the specific requirements of your refrigerator model, ensuring you follow best practices for upkeep. Ignoring these guidelines can lead to inadequate protection for your appliance.

Environmental factors such as high humidity or frequent power surges can increase wear on a stabilizer, necessitating more frequent inspections. In such cases, investing in a high-quality stabilizer may yield better results and longevity.
